I could only get it working with the full page shopping cart widget but here goes anyway. In the below example I've replaced the angle brackets with # so it will render. The only part you should need to worry about is the src tag in the iframe. Add &galleryname=YourGalleryName with + instead of spaces. I've used my Another World gallery below as an example.

#iframe id='pixelsshoppingcartiframe' src='https://fineartamerica.com/widgetshoppingcart/artwork.html?memberidtype=artistid&memberid=223454&domainid=0&showheader=0&height=600&autoheight=true&galleryname=Another+World' style='display: inline-block; width: 100%; height: 820px; border: none; overflow: hidden;##/iframe#
